07 Apr 2016

NewsFlash: H1B Cap Reached!

The U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) announced today that the H1B cap limit for fiscal year 2017 (FY17) has been reached. This applies to both the 65,000 regular H1B cap limit as well as the 20,000 advanced degree (masters) cap exemptions.As the H1B case...
